LISBON – Portugal capital city During the last centuries Lisboa was one of the most important ports in the world which brought prosperity. So the center of the town gives you impression of power and wealth –you can see beautiful squares, fortresses, churches and monuments.; on the other side there are suburbs populated by the poor. Portugal is situated on the east side of the Iberian peninsula. The Romans founded their fortresses on the estuary of the river Douro and named them Portus Cale. Later this name was used for the whole country–Portucalis. It borders on Spain (border is 1200 km long). The Portuguese coast is 848 km long (along the Atlantic ocean). The capital is Lisbon.
